Population Overview

Tamaqua borough is a small city located in Pennsylvania, within Schuylkill County. The total population is 6,922. It ranks as the 169th most populous out of 1,993 cities and towns in Pennsylvania.

Age Demographics

The median age in Tamaqua borough is 36.6 years. This is 11% lower than the state median of 40.9 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Tamaqua borough is $44,803. This is 41% lower than the state median of $76,081.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 43% lower. The poverty rate stands at 26.1%. This is 121% higher than the state poverty rate of 11.8%. With more than one in five residents living below the poverty line, economic hardship is a significant challenge for the community. The unemployment rate is 3.7%. This is 30% lower than the state rate of 5.3%. The median home value is $78,500. Housing costs are 67% lower than the state median of $240,500.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 1.8x, Tamaqua borough is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 56.3%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 19% lower than the state average of 69.3%.

Race & Ethnicity

The largest racial or ethnic group in Tamaqua borough is White (non-Hispanic), making up 82.3% of the population.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 13.6%. The Black or African American population (0.4%) is well below the state average of 10.3%. The Hispanic or Latino population is significantly higher than the state average (13.6% vs 8.4%).

Education

16.3%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 53% lower than the state rate of 34.5%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 89.2%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Tamaqua borough, Pennsylvania is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Pennsylvania state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 1,993 Census-designated places in Pennsylvania. For official data, visit data.census.gov.
